The status of fusion research

R S Pease1987年Plasma Physics and Controlled FusionIF 2.2出版社

The objective of nuclear fusion research is to find out whether or not the nuclear energy of thelight elements, especially that released when hydrogen isotopes react to form helium, can be putto practical use to provide a virtually limitless source of energy. This research has beenconducted on an increasing scale since 1946 when a patent was taken out by Thomson and Blackmann (1946) to produce high temperatures and D-D thermonuclear fusion reactions in a toroidal electricdischarge of about 500 kA. Nowadays the research is carried out on a scale of several hundredmillion dollars a year in each of Western Europe, the U.S.A, Japan and the Soviet Union.
